The Ancient Irish Epic Tale Tain Bo Cualnge HERE NOW FOLLOWETH THE DISGUISING OF TAMON / HERE NOW COMETH THE HEAD-PLACE OF FERCHU / XXIII / HERE FOLLOWETH THE TOOTH-FIGHT OF FINTAN; lines 12389-12451 confidence: high
Fintan's people offer three battles, kill thrice their own number, and all fall except Fintan and Crimthann; Crimthann is saved under a canopy of shields by Ailill and Medb and separated from Fintan.
Crimthann is saved by Ailill and Medb, then returned to Fintan as part of an agreement that stops Fintan's attacks until a later battle.
